A resonant circuit in a radio receiver is tuned to a certain station when the inductor has a value of 1.00 µH and the capacitor has a value of 1.90 pF. The resistance of the circuit is 2.00 O.
(a) Find the frequency of the radio station.
MHz
(b) Is there any information given in the problem that is not needed to solve it? (Select all that apply.) value of capacitance value of induction value of resistance all values are needed.
